Wisconsin volleyball knocks off Stanford in Sweet 16, moves to Elite 8
Updated Dec. 12, 2025, 7:56 p.m. CT
AUSTIN, Texas – Wisconsin volleyball has long eyed a deep postseason run.
In the NCAA tournament regional semifinals, the third-seeded Badgers fully looked the part as they outdueled second-seeded Stanford in four sets, 25-17, 21-25, 25-23, 25-22, to advance to the NCAA regional finals for the eighth consecutive season.
“The level of talent out there on the court and the level of play out there – that easily could have been a Final Four match,” Wisconsin coach Kelly Sheffield said afterward. “It’s unusual to see that high level and back and forth in the Sweet 16.”
